2.) Equinox is less attended than Spring Infra, however always expect a line. Come later in the afternoon for no line, but expect less spots available for your campsite.

4.) Go visit the point. Watch a nighttime set at treehouse stage, especially if it’s raining. Stay at silent disco until they shut it down. Catch the first sets of the day. If you run into a campsite filled with 3-D printed stuff, stop by and chat with the guy he’s super nice and gives away a lot of it. If you see a mailbox, open it. Find a phone in the strings area and it might sing you Natasha Bedingfield’s Unwritten. Bring dollar bills to chuck at artists, always tip your dubtender. Do not miss the crawboil; there will be free food.

5.) If you have iPhone I highly recommend sharing location with the homies. It’s a small festival and easy to find people.

8.) There’s a ton of trance this year if that’s what you mean. Infinity Project and S.P.Y. also lots of riddim from Bommer and Hurtbox. Do not miss Casey Club at 360 stage that’s gonna be so hype. Also Distinct Motive had the crowd soooo rowdy last fall they gave him a 2 hour set this fall. 360 stage will have a lot of the “hype” vibes.
